Job Title: Compliance Specialist Location: Remote Schedule: Full-Time Pay Rate: $30-$32/hr. Employment Type: Contract - 3-4 month anticipated assignment Job Description: LHH Recruitment Solutions is partnering with a well-established national organization to identify an experienced Real Estate Licensing Compliance Analyst. This role is ideal for a detail-oriented compliance professional with extensive multi-state real estate licensing experience who thrives in a collaborative, service-oriented environment. The successful candidate will oversee real estate brokerage and individual licensing matters across multiple jurisdictions, ensuring compliance with state regulatory requirements while partnering closely with internal stakeholders. This position offers the opportunity to work independently while supporting a highly collaborative legal and compliance team. Responsibilities:
- Manage multi-state real estate brokerage and individual licensing, including new applications, renewals, amendments, reciprocal licenses, and surrenders
- Research state real estate licensing requirements and ensure ongoing compliance with applicable regulations
- Maintain and update licensing records and reporting within internal licensing management systems
- Monitor license renewals, continuing education requirements, and regulatory deadlines
- Coordinate with state real estate commissions, designated brokers, and internal business partners regarding licensing matters
- Complete license verification requests and resolve licensing discrepancies
- Prepare and submit licensing applications and related documentation through state licensing portals
- Support designated broker changes and other brokerage licensing updates
- Generate licensing reports and provide compliance updates to internal stakeholders
- Reconcile licensing-related expenses and maintain accurate documentation
- Maintain organized electronic records while handling confidential information with discretion
- 5+ years of experience in real estate brokerage licensing or regulatory compliance (real estate brokerage experience required; mortgage licensing experience alone is not sufficient)
- Demonstrated experience managing multi-state real estate licensing for both individuals and brokerage entities
- Experience coordinating designated broker changes
- Strong understanding of state real estate licensing regulations and compliance requirements
- Excellent organizational skills with exceptional attention to detail
- Strong written and verbal communication skills with a customer-service mindset
- 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ment while working independently
- Proficiency with Microsoft Office and Google Workspace
- Experience using Airtable or similar licensing management platforms
- Familiarity with Canadian real estate licensing requirements
- Bachelor's degree or equivalent professional experience
